DISKGEN命令詳解

現在可供選用的硬盤分區工具軟件很多,但基本上都是“外國貨”,只有被譽爲分區小超人的DISKMAN是地地道道的國貨。DISKMAN以其操作直觀簡便的特點爲菜鳥級電腦用戶所喜愛,但在近兩年的時間裏,DISKMAN的版本一直停留在V1.2,總不見作者推出升級版本,不免讓人爲它擔心。現在,2.0版本的DISKMAN終於出現了,仍然是免費軟件,只是名子改成了Disk Genius。經過近兩年的潛心“修煉”,Disk Genius的“功力”確實不可當日而語,它不僅提供了基本的硬盤分區功能(如建立、激活、刪除、隱藏分區),還具有強大的分區維護功能(如分區表備份和恢復、分區參數修改、硬盤主引導記錄修復、重建分區表等);此外,它還具有分區格式化、分區無損調整、硬盤表面掃描、扇區拷貝、徹底清除扇區數據等實用功能。雖然Disk Genius功能更強大了,但它的身材依然“苗條”,只有區區143KB。

一、Disk Genius的主要功能及特點

1、仿WINDOWS純中文圖形界面,無須任何漢字系統支持,以圖表的形式揭示了分區表的詳細結構,支持鼠標操作;
2、提供比fdisk更靈活的分區操作,支持分區參數編輯;
3、提供強大的分區表重建功能,迅速修復損壞了的分區表;
4、支持FAT/FAT32分區的快速格式化;
5、在不破壞數據的情況下直接調整FAT/FAT32分區的大小;
6、自動重建被破壞的硬盤主引導記錄;
7、爲防止誤操作,對於簡單的分區操作,在存盤之前僅更改內存緩衝區,不影響硬盤分區表;
8、能查看硬盤任意扇區,並可保存到文件。
9、可隱藏FAT/FAT32及NTFS分區。
10、可備份包括邏輯分區表及各分區引導記錄在內的所有硬盤分區信息。
11、提供掃描硬盤壞區功能,報告損壞的柱面。
12、具備扇區拷貝功能。
13、可以徹底清除分區數據。

二、Disk Genius運行界面


如果你只是想利用Disk Genius查看、備份硬盤分區信息,可以在直接在WINDOWS 9x下運行本軟件。但如果涉及更改分區參數的寫盤操作,則必須在純DOS環境下運行,而且在使用前應將“BIOS設置”中的“Anti Virus”選項設爲“Disable”。

運行“DiskGen.exe”啓動本軟件後,將自動讀取硬盤的分區信息,並在屏幕上以圖表的形式顯示硬盤分區情況。圖1是Disk Genius檢測筆者硬盤得到的分區信息結構圖。左側的柱狀圖顯示硬盤上各分區的位置及大小,最底部的分區爲第一個分區。通過柱狀圖各部分的顏色和是否帶網格,可以判斷分區的類型,灰顏色的部分爲自由空間(不屬任何分區),不帶網格的分區爲主分區,帶網格的爲擴展分區,擴展分區又進一步劃分成邏輯分區(邏輯盤D、E、F…)。屏幕右側用表格的形式顯示了各分區的類型及其具體參數,包括分區的引導標誌、系統標誌,分區起始和終止柱面號、扇區號、磁頭號。如果你對這些參數的意義不太懂,可以參閱幫助文件中“關於分區表”的內容。

在柱狀圖與參數表格之間,有一個動態連線指示了它們之間的對應關係。你可以通過鼠標在柱狀圖或表格中點擊來選擇一個分區,也可以用鍵盤上的光標移動鍵來選擇當前分區。用“TAB”或“SHIFT-TAB”鍵可在柱狀圖和表格之間選擇。當你選擇了一個FAT或FAT32分區後,表格下部的窗口中將會顯示關於這個分區的一些信息:分區的總扇區數、總簇數和簇的大小,兩份FAT表、根目錄、數據區的開始柱面號、磁頭號、扇區號。

特別提示:分區參數表格的第0~3項分別對應硬盤主分區表的四個表項,而第4、5、6…項分別對應邏輯盤D、E、F…。當硬盤只有一個DOS主分區和擴展分區時(利用FDISK進行分區的硬盤一般都是這樣的),“第0項”表示主分區(邏輯盤C)的分區信息,“第1項”表示擴展分區的信息,“第2、第3項”則全部爲零,不對應任何分區,所以無法選中。筆者曾在某網站論壇上發現一張有關DISKMAN疑問的帖子,詢問有沒有辦法將分區參數表格中全部爲零的“第2項、第3項”刪除掉, 這當然是不可能的,發帖者顯然對硬盤分區知識缺乏瞭解。想真正弄懂分區參數表格中各項的意義,必須瞭解硬盤分區錶鏈結構,建議有興趣的朋友多找一些相關資料看看。

三、使用說明

1. 備份及恢復分區表:

啓動本軟件後,按F9鍵,或選擇“工具”菜單下的“備份分區表”項,在彈出的對話框中輸入文件名(默認保存在A盤上),即可備份當前分區表。按F10鍵,或選擇“工具”菜單下的“恢復分區表”項,然後輸入文件名(默認從A盤讀取),本軟件將讀入指定的分區表備份文件,並更新屏幕顯示,在你確認無誤後,可將備份的分區表恢復到硬盤。

2. 建立分區:

未建立分區的硬盤空間(即自由空間)在分區結構圖中顯示爲灰色,只有在硬盤的自由空間才能新建分區。

要建立主分區(Primary),先選中分區結構圖中的灰色區域,按ENTER鍵;然後按提示輸入分區大小,選擇分區類型(要建立非DOS分區,還須根據提示設定系統標誌,如建立Linux分區,系統標誌爲“83”)。利用本軟件,你最多可以建立四個DOS主分區。存盤前如用戶未設置啓動分區,則自動激活第一個主分區。

要建立擴展分區,先選中分區結構圖中的灰色區域,按F5鍵,在彈出的提示框中輸入分區大小後確認。擴展分區建立後,還要將其進一步劃分爲多個邏輯分區(邏輯盤)才能使用,方法是:選中新建立的擴展分區(綠色區域)後,按ENTER鍵,其後的操作與建立主分區時相同。

提示:當硬盤上已有一個擴展分區時,就不能再建擴展分區了。如果你想將某個與擴展分區相鄰的自由空間再劃成擴展分區(即擴大“擴展分區”的範圍),只能採取先刪除已有的擴展分區,然後再重建才行。

3. 激活分區、刪除分區、隱藏分區:

選中要激活的主分區,按F7鍵即可將其設定爲活動分區,活動分區的系統名稱將以紅色顯示。

選中某一分區,按F4鍵即可隱藏該分區,再次按F4鍵恢復;按Delete鍵或F6鍵即可刪除選定分區。

提示:如刪除主分區,其所在空間轉化爲自由空間(變成灰色區域);如刪除某一個邏輯分區(如D、E…盤)後,其所在空間並不變成自由空間,而是轉化爲未使用的擴展分區(變成綠色區域

4.調整分區大小

本軟件能在不損壞任何數據的情況下,直接調整FAT16或FAT32分區的大小。方法是:選擇要調整的分區,在“分區”菜單下選擇“調整分區大小”命令,然後按提示操作。建議在調整前運行WINDOWS系統的“磁盤掃描程序”檢查硬盤錯誤並糾正,並做好重要文件的備份。不可以在調整過程中強行中斷或關機(重新啓動)。否則,被調整分區上的數據將會全部丟失。

不過,筆者發現,Disk Genius的分區調整操作實際上只是將分區的終止柱面數、磁頭數、扇區數在可能的範圍內(即沒有數據的區域)作調整,並不能真正挪動分區的起始位置。所以此項功能似乎用處並不大。

5. 修改分區參數:

選中要修改的分區,按F11鍵進入修改狀態(如圖2),將光標移動到要修改的參數,鍵入你要設定的值。修改完畢後選“確定”退出。

提示:用此法可調整分區的起始和終止柱面號、磁頭號、扇區號,從而調整分區大小,但可能會造成邏輯盤(數據)丟失,不熟悉分區參數含義的用戶要慎用此功能。

6. 重建分區表:

當硬盤分區表被病毒或其他原因破壞時,Disk Genius通過未被破壞的分區引導記錄信息(主要是搜索分區表結束標誌55AA)重新建立分區表。搜索過程可以採用“自動”或“交互”兩種方式進行。自動方式保留髮現的每一個分區,適用於大多數情況。交互方式對發現的每一個分區都給出提示,由用戶選擇是否保留。當自動方式重建的分區表不正確時,可以採用交互方式重新搜索。重建過程中,搜索到的分區都將及時顯示在屏幕上。但不立即存盤,因此,你可以反覆搜索,直到正確的建立分區表之後再存盤。此功能的操作非常簡單,只需選擇執行“工具”菜單下的“重建分區”命令即可。

此功能是修復邏輯盤丟失故障最簡便的方法,特別是“治療”因使用Pqmagic不當導致的種種硬盤故障的“特效藥”。
參考資料:http://www.chinadforce.com/archiver/?tid-594128.html 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章